A nurse is working in the emergency department during a mass casualty incident involving a suspected bioterrorism attack with anthrax exposure. Which nursing intervention should be the priority when caring for potentially exposed patients?

The emergency department has received multiple patients from a downtown office building where a suspicious white powder was found scattered throughout the lobby and several floors. Initial reports suggest possible anthrax exposure, and patients are presenting with various symptoms including respiratory distress, skin lesions, and anxiety.

Decontamination is the immediate priority to prevent further exposure and cross-contamination in a suspected anthrax bioterrorism event.

In a mass casualty bioterrorism event with suspected anthrax exposure, the immediate priority is implementing decontamination procedures and removing contaminated clothing. This intervention is important for several reasons related to infection control and patient safety.

Anthrax is caused by Bacillus anthracis, a spore-forming bacterium that can be used as a biological weapon. When released in aerosol or powder form, anthrax spores can contaminate clothing, skin, and personal belongings, creating an ongoing exposure risk for patients, healthcare workers, and medical facilities. Immediate decontamination prevents further absorption of spores through the skin and eliminates the ongoing source of exposure.

The decontamination process involves systematically removing contaminated clothing in a controlled manner, followed by thoroughly washing exposed skin areas with soap and water. This intervention should be performed before patients enter main treatment areas to prevent contamination throughout the facility. Healthcare workers must use appropriate personal protective equipment (PPE) during decontamination procedures.

From a nursing perspective, decontamination achieves several goals: it reduces the patient's bacterial load, prevents cross-contamination to other patients and staff, and allows for a more accurate assessment of the actual exposure level. This intervention also reduces patient anxiety by providing an immediate and visible action that addresses concerns about contamination.

The decontamination process should be carried out in an organized and systematic manner in designated areas with appropriate ventilation and waste disposal protocols. Nurses play a crucial role in coordinating this process while maintaining patient dignity and providing emotional support during what can be a traumatic experience.

Understanding the Priority in a Biological Mass Casualty Incident

In a mass casualty incident involving a suspected bioterrorism agent like anthrax, the immediate priority is always safety—both for the patients and the healthcare providers. The foundational principle of CBRN (Chemical, Biological, Radiological, and Nuclear) casualty management is that a contaminated patient poses a direct risk of secondary exposure to staff and other patients, which can quickly disable a hospital's ability to function [3, 4]. Before any medical intervention, including diagnostics or treatment, can be safely and effectively delivered, the source of ongoing contamination must be eliminated.



The correct intervention is to implement decontamination procedures and remove contaminated clothing. Removing clothing alone can eliminate up to 80-90% of the contaminant, immediately reducing the dose of the agent the patient is absorbing and the risk of off-gassing or contact transfer to others . This step is not merely a comfort measure; it is a critical, evidence-based clinical intervention that directly mitigates the progression of toxicity and protects the treatment environment. In the context of anthrax, which does not spread from person to person via the inhalational route but can be transferred via spores on skin and clothing, this action is the definitive first step to break the chain of contamination [4].




Analysis of Incorrect Options


  • Option 1: Administering broad-spectrum antibiotics is a critical component of post-exposure prophylaxis and treatment for anthrax. However, doing so prior to decontamination is premature. If a patient is still covered in a powdered substance, the ongoing absorption of the agent continues, undermining the effectiveness of the medication. Furthermore, the act of administering medication brings healthcare workers into close proximity with a contaminated patient without first establishing safety, which contradicts standard CBRN response principles [2, 3].

  • Option 2: Isolating patients in negative pressure rooms is a standard infection control practice for diseases spread via the airborne route, such as tuberculosis or measles. Anthrax is not transmitted person-to-person via the respiratory route, making negative pressure isolation unnecessary for the organism's transmission dynamics. More critically, moving a contaminated patient through a hospital to an isolation room without decontamination spreads the contaminant through hallways and contaminates the room itself, creating a larger hazard and potentially disabling critical hospital infrastructure [1, 3].

  • Option 4: Collecting laboratory specimens before initiating treatment is a standard diagnostic workflow in non-disaster settings. In a CBRN incident, however, the "treat first, confirm later" paradigm often applies. Delaying decontamination to collect a specimen prolongs the patient's exposure and the risk to staff. While laboratory confirmation is important for public health and definitive diagnosis, it is a secondary priority to the immediate life-saving and risk-mitigating step of decontamination [3, 4].




The Hospital's Role in Biological Disaster Response

Hospitals are vital organizations in the response to biological disasters, yet studies show there are no universally accepted standards for preparedness . A systematic review of hospital-based preparedness for CBRNe disasters emphasizes that the most critical element is having a standardized, well-equipped, and well-rehearsed decontamination process before patients enter the main treatment areas . This "all-hazards" approach ensures that the initial response—decontamination—is a reflexive and correctly prioritized action, regardless of whether the agent is definitively identified as chemical, biological, or radiological . The primary lesson is that a live patient who is decontaminated has a far better prognosis than a patient who receives sophisticated medical care while still covered in a hazardous substance.

Clinical Practice Guide: Mass Casualty Decontamination for Biological Agents
Situation & Background

A mass casualty incident involving a suspected biological agent, such as anthrax, requires immediate action to prevent secondary contamination of the healthcare facility. The principle of "safety first" dictates that no medical intervention occurs before gross decontamination. Removing contaminated clothing alone can eliminate up to 90% of the contaminant, drastically reducing the patient's absorbed dose and the risk of cross-contamination to staff and other patients.

Priority Nursing Actions
  1. Secure the Scene & Don PPE: Before patient contact, ensure the scene is safe and all healthcare providers are in appropriate personal protective equipment (PPE) per hospital CBRN protocols (e.g., powered air-purifying respirators, chemical-resistant gowns, double gloves).
  2. Implement Gross Decontamination: Direct ambulatory patients to a designated external decontamination area. For non-ambulatory patients, use a structured team approach. The first step is the systematic removal of all clothing, cutting garments off if necessary to avoid spreading contamination to the face.
  3. Perform Technical Decontamination: After clothing removal, instruct patients to wash their entire body with copious amounts of soap and water, starting from the head and moving downward. Collect all runoff water and contaminated items as hazardous waste per facility policy.
  4. Re-Triage and Medical Care: Once decontamination is complete, patients are re-triaged based on clinical presentation. Only at this point should specimen collection, antibiotic administration, and other medical interventions begin. For suspected anthrax, treatment with ciprofloxacin or doxycycline is initiated promptly post-decontamination.
Key Safety Reminders
  • Anthrax is not airborne-transmissible person-to-person: Standard precautions are sufficient post-decontamination; negative pressure isolation is not required.
  • Do not delay decontamination for diagnostics: Specimen collection (e.g., nasal swabs, blood cultures) is secondary to the immediate safety need of removing the contaminant.
  • Psychological support: Acknowledge patient anxiety and provide clear, calm instructions throughout the decontamination process to manage the "worried well" and maintain order.

  • Anthrax (탄저병) — An infectious disease caused by the gram-positive rod-shaped bacterium Bacillus anthracis. It forms spores that can survive for long periods in the environment, making it a potential bioterrorism agent. There are inhalation, cutaneous, and gastrointestinal forms.
  • Decontamination (제독) — The process of removing or neutralizing hazardous substances (chemical, biological, radiological) on people or equipment to reduce them to safe levels. In bioterrorism, removing contaminated clothing and washing the skin are key.
  • Bioterrorism (생물테러) — The act of deliberately spreading pathogens (bacteria, viruses, etc.) or their toxins to harm people, animals, or plants, or to cause social fear.
  • Mass Casualty Incident (대량 사상자 사건) — An incident where the number of patients exceeds medical resources and response capacity. Triage (patient classification) is essential for effective response, and decontamination may be an initial common step.
  • Personal Protective Equipment — Equipment worn by medical staff to protect themselves from sources of infection or hazardous substances. In this case, N95 or higher-level respirators, waterproof gowns, double gloves, safety goggles, and face shields may be required.
